BACKGROUND

WUSC is a Canadian global development organization working to catalyze positive education and economic outcomes for young people. We bring together and collaborate with a diverse network of partners (including students, volunteers, schools, governments, not-for-profits, and businesses) who share this mission. Together, we influence systems change, and foster inclusive, youth-centered solutions that enable young people to thrive. We work with all young people, with a focus on women and displaced populations. WUSC currently operates in 28 countries across Africa, Asia, the Middle East, and Latin America and the Caribbean, as well as in Canada, with an annual budget of approximately CAD $65 million. Our global team includes over 100 staff in Canada and more than 250 staff internationally, implementing a diverse portfolio of development projects in collaboration with numerous multilateral and bilateral donors, and philanthropic foundations.

Responsibilities

Contact Management & Data Analytics

  • Maintain Salesforce data integrity through accurate contact and donation records and systematic deduplication
  • Execute data cleaning through email validation, and data enrichment through research and outreach to update contact information of alumni and donor prospects
  • Manage segmented mailing lists and ensure proper data syncing between platforms (e.g. Salesforce, MailChimp)
  • Build and interpret regular fundraising reports covering revenue, campaign performance, and donor behaviour trends.
  • Lead documentation of data processes and strategically engage external analytics consultants.

Donation Processing

  • Process and record all donations in Salesforce according to established procedures
  • Generate tax receipts following CRA guidelines and maintain comprehensive gift processing records
  • Monitor donation platforms (e.g. CanadaHelps, Raisin) for system issues and maintain quality donor experience through updated content and automated communications
  • Document and update gift processing procedures, flagging any opportunities to improve processes and workflows between departments
  • Collaborate with IT and Finance team on system integrations, including ERP updates and Salesforce donation feature testing
